Incorporating an Emerald Birthstone Ring into a Classic Outfit
These rings have been around for a very long time. In fact, when you think of gemstones, you probably think of sapphires, rubies, diamonds and emeralds. However, if this is your first time buying one of these emerald jewelry pieces it can be a little bit daunting when you go to the store. You might just want to stick with a very elegant design style so the color doesn’t just seem to be sticking out like a sore thumb.
One thing that you can try is to go with very classic style. This might be a very basic sheath dress. Of course you could just use a ring that has a spot of color to your outfit. You could also try wearing a green handbag or a fun color of ballet flats so that things really relate to each other.
The other option would be just to go all green. Of course, this probably isn’t the best idea if you are wearing pants because this kind of style is really flattering on anyone. However, a green dress can be very striking with this kind of piece. You could again stick with the very traditional look then go with a nontraditional color. This allows you to put your own personal stamp on your outfit. Plus, if you stop at a dinner party and everyone else is wearing kind of the same little simple dress yours is really going to stand out but in a good way.
Incorporate sparkle into to your outfit. This can end up feeling very formal and elegant. For instance if you are bridesmaid or just going to a formal event you could try going with a satin dress. This can have a very subtle sheen to it that is also going to relate back to the sparkle of your jewelry.
